At 612 PM CDT, Doppler radar was tracking a cluster of strong thunderstorms from northeastern Crockett County into northwestern Sutton County, moving northeast at 25 mph. HAZARD...Wind gusts up to 50 mph and nickel size hail. SOURCE...Radar indicated. IMPACT...Gusty winds could knock down tree limbs and blow around unsecured objects. Minor hail damage to vegetation is possible. Locations impacted include... Eldorado, The Intersection Of Ranch Road 1828 And Ranch Road 915, The Intersection Of Us- 190 And Ranch Road 1828, The Intersection Of Us 190 And Highway 163, and Us-190 Near The Crockett-Sutton County Line. P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S... If outdoors, consider seeking shelter inside a building.
